A part-time HR job typically involves supporting the daily operations of an HR department, with responsibilities ranging from assisting with recruitment and onboarding to managing benefits and employee relations. Part-time HR roles often focus on specific areas within HR or provide general support for HR functions.
Here's a more detailed look at what a part-time HR role might entail:
Common Responsibilities:
Recruitment and Onboarding:
Assisting with job postings, screening resumes, scheduling interviews, and onboarding new employees.
Employee Relations:
Addressing employee inquiries, handling grievances, and maintaining positive workplace relations.
Benefits Administration:
Managing benefits programs, processing payroll tasks, and ensuring compliance with benefits policies.
Record-Keeping:
Maintaining accurate employee records, including personal details, employment contracts, and performance evaluations.
Compliance:
Assisting with compliance-related tasks, ensuring adherence to employment laws and regulations.
Training and Development:
Coordinating or providing training programs for employees.
Administrative Support:
Providing administrative support to the HR department, including answering phones, sorting mail, and managing schedules.
Skills and Qualifications:
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
Knowledge of HR principles, policies, and procedures.
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and HR software.
Experience with HR functions such as recruitment, onboarding, and benefits administration.
